# Cold Start Limits — Fenwick Functions

Quick primer for new folks: our serverless handlers on the Fenwick platform get frozen after idle periods, and the first request afterward eats the cold-start penalty. We keep a small pool of pre-warmed workers, but quotas cap how many you get per team. Don't try to game it with keepalive pings — the scheduler notices. The current quota and warmup constants are listed below.

limits module of hahap-yafog:
THRESHOLDS = {
    "weneth": 555,
    "jorix": 223,
    "eliius": 753,
}

Root cause: our 3.2 release changed the default font-metric stub used during snapshot rendering, so every baseline image shifted by two pixels. Plugin authors: this was not a fault in your components. We have restored the old stub behind a compatibility flag and regenerated the canonical baselines. If your pipeline pinned our renderer, rebaseline against the restored stub. The corrected renderer build is identified by the token below.

session token of kawip-yajeg = htk6_209e95

Handover, Priya to Oskar, Emberline loyalty ledger. Ledger writes are append-only; corrections go through adjustment entries, never deletes. Nightly balance snapshot runs at 01:30 and must finish before the partner export. Release manager: the pending 4.2 release changes the rounding rule for split redemptions — gate it behind the flag until finance signs off. Replay tooling is in the ops repo. No open incidents. The service currently runs with the configuration values listed below.

config for kawif-hahig:
zorix:
  log_level: error
  metrics_host: metrics.zorix.lumiclabs.internal
  pool_size: 16

CI note: Greenhouse controller drift tests (Fernhollow)

If the drift-compensation suite fails intermittently, it's almost always the simulated humidity sensor, not your change. The mock sensor seeds from wall-clock time; back-to-back runs within the same second collide. Re-run once before debugging. If it fails twice, check whether the calibration fixture was regenerated — stale fixtures report pre-drift baselines. Don't touch the tolerance constants. The last known-good build token is recorded below.

session token of kageg-tahop = htk14_af3c1ccccb7dcf